Water-dispersible "core-shell type microparticles"

Core-corona structured granules with hydrophilic units arranged radially.

Core-corona type particles have a structure in which hydrophilic units are arranged radially from a core part made up of hydrophobic units. There are grades with corona parts of different ionicities, and they are stabilized in dispersion in water by the hydrophilic units on the particle surface. When core-corona type polymer microparticles are used as a binder for the anode of lithium-ion secondary batteries, they show a higher capacity retention rate and better rate characteristics compared to anodes using conventional binders. 【Features of Core-Corona Type Binders】 - Strong adhesion to the active material surface due to the functional group effects of the corona chains - Low electrode resistance - Does not swell in electrolyte - Enables the production of batteries capable of high-speed charge and discharge For more details, please contact us or download the catalog.

Core corona type binder for electric double layer capacitors [Senka Elevaine]

Proposal for a binder for electric double-layer capacitors! An increase in capacitance is expected!

<AN-155A> Our company has refined the synthesis technology of water-dispersible polymer microparticles known as "core-corona type microparticles," focusing on their application in the battery field. Based on the technology developed for LiB anode binders, we have newly developed "AN-155A," which can further increase the capacitance of electric double-layer capacitors. The newly developed product has shown approximately 1.6 times the capacitance improvement compared to our conventional product "AN-110K," and about 1.2 times compared to commercially available SBR, by optimizing the polymer design. SEM images have also shown that the binder particles are uniformly dispersed on the surface of activated carbon compared to commercially available SBR, confirming that the binding state of the binder is different. It is a water-based binder that can be used in the same way as SBR.

High-speed mold casting method "Cold Box Binder"

Contributing to the total cost reduction of cast metal production! Environmentally friendly binder solutions.

The "Cold Box Binder" is a high-speed molding method that does not require heat. It reduces the machining of cast products due to improved dimensional accuracy of the cores. High-speed molding achieves increased productivity, energy savings, and labor savings, enabling a total cost reduction in casting production. Without compromising the high production efficiency inherent to the Cold Box Binder, we offer products such as "ECOC URE HE," which allows for a reduction in binder usage, and "ECOC URE SL," which contains no solvents and is suitable for iron and aluminum castings. 【Features】 ■ Fast molding speed ■ Energy saving/CO2 reduction ■ Improved dimensional accuracy of cores ■ Reduced machining of cast products ■ Usable with wooden molds, resin molds, and aluminum molds ■ Suitable for small-scale production *For more details, please refer to the catalog or feel free to contact us at info.japan@ask-chemicals.com.

Hydro Chromic White C-1224

Reversible functional ink! Usable on various fibers such as cotton, polyester, and non-woven fabric.

"Hydro Chromic White C-1224" is a water-based functional binder for screen printing on various fibers such as cotton, polyester, nylon, and their blends. When this product is printed on fibers, the coating instantly changes from white to transparent when wet with water after drying. Once dry, it returns to its original opaque white state. The coating is flexible, excellent in water resistance and friction strength, making it suitable for functional applications in toys, such as diapers for milk-only dolls. 【Features】 ■ Flexible and excellent in water resistance and friction strength ■ Instantly changes from white to transparent when wet with water ■ Returns from transparent to white state once dry ■ Can conceal the underdrawing by using it on printed fabric ■ By incorporating Neo Color, it is possible to enhance opacity further *For more details, please refer to the PDF document or feel free to contact us.

Inorganic binder "General-purpose Binder FJ294"

Widely applicable for surface treatment of photocatalysts, enhancing heat resistance and strength of inorganic fibers and fabrics!

The "General-purpose Binder FJ294" is a 100% inorganic, water-based, single-component inorganic binder. It forms a transparent glass film with high water resistance and heat resistance. It is widely used as a raw material for adhesives and inorganic coatings, as well as for pre-treatment of photocatalysts, enhancing the heat resistance and strength of inorganic fibers and fabrics, and as a rust-proof primer for steel plates. 【Features】 ■ 100% inorganic, water-based, single-component ■ Rapidly cures through the evaporation of moisture (dehydration condensation reaction) ■ The liquid itself is odorless and does not emit volatile substances or harmful gases during drying ■ Excellent heat and water resistance, can solidify substrates through application or impregnation, and can be formed into shapes by adding fillers or aggregates ■ Viscosity can be adjusted as desired by adding water or hot water *For more details, please refer to the PDF materials or feel free to contact us.

Inorganic binder "Inorganic Film Agent FJ210"

Forms a flexible inorganic film layer with excellent gas barrier properties! Greatly enhances fire resistance!

The "Inorganic Film Agent FJ210" is a water-based, one-component inorganic binder. It forms a flexible inorganic film layer with excellent gas barrier properties, suppressing the release of combustion gases from within the substrate and significantly enhancing fire resistance. It is effective in preventing combustion and reducing heat generation in non-combustible building materials, resin molded products, and wood. 【Features】 - The coated surface forms a gas barrier layer, suppressing the release of combustion gases from the backside, making ignition more difficult. - The coated surface has moderate flexibility, allowing it to accommodate slight deformations at high temperatures. - It is a water-based, one-component inorganic system, and being neutral, it is easy to handle. *For more details, please refer to the PDF document or feel free to contact us.

High-performance binder for electrodes 'Kureha KF Polymer'

High-performance binder suitable for electrodes: Polyvinylidene fluoride (PVDF)

"Kureha KF Polymer" is a high-quality polyvinylidene fluoride (PVDF) resin with various features. Since its adoption in practical lithium-ion batteries (LiB), it has a proven track record of many applications. It has high adhesion, chemical resistance, and excellent electrochemical stability, making it suitable for LiB applications. [Features] - Adopted not only for consumer applications but also for automotive, industrial, and stationary LiBs. - Various variations are available, including high molecular weight, functional group modifications, and solution types. *For more details, please download the PDF or contact us.

PTFE binder for batteries

The charge and discharge behavior against the C-rate is excellent! Outstanding cycle characteristics.

We offer a "PTFE binder for batteries" that is insoluble and fibrous, which fixes the active material and does not inhibit the action of ions. PTFE has excellent chemical resistance, extending the battery's lifespan and maintaining performance over a long period, even in environments exposed to corrosive electrolytes. Additionally, it has excellent thermal stability, allowing for stable battery performance even under high-temperature conditions. 【Features】 ■ High C-rate characteristics ■ Excellent cycle characteristics ■ Advantages in the manufacturing process *For more details, please download the PDF or feel free to contact us.

Cationic binder materials (such as polyester with high adhesion).

Our water-soluble phenolic resin demonstrates high adhesion even to substrates without bonding agents, such as polyester and cellulose.

We would like to introduce "cationic binder" as an application example of water-soluble phenolic resin from Kohnishi Chemical Industry Co., Ltd. We have found that water-soluble phenolic resins exhibit high adhesion even to substrates without bonding groups, such as polyester and cellulose. In addition to the hydrogen bonding strength between the hydroxyl groups of DHDPS and the carbonyl or hydroxyl groups of the substrate, the crosslinking (thermosetting) utilizing the methylol group at the end of the resol-type water-soluble phenolic resin demonstrates high robustness. 【Features】 - Optimization of the molar ratio and molecular weight of DHDPS and sulfonic compounds - High adhesion to substrates without bonding groups - High robustness *For more details, please refer to the PDF document or feel free to contact us.

Next, use the binder KL-2.

Adhesive binder with shrinkage based on silicone.

By applying it to permeable substrates (such as blocks, bricks, and wood), it is possible to form a thin film that prevents water from penetrating the surface of the substrate. Additionally, since the formed film has siloxane bonds, it exhibits good weather resistance for outdoor use and is less prone to degradation from ultraviolet rays compared to acrylic and urethane resin coatings. Furthermore, due to its elasticity, when used in textile products, it can maintain a soft texture compared to conventional resin-based binders. *For more details, please refer to the PDF document or feel free to contact us.*
